The Senior Procurement Analyst manages the contract documentation lifecycle, including the intake, review, assessment, and storage of service provider insurance certificates, vendor reviews, and other contract-required documentation. The role develops tools and systems to support contract management, review, assessment, and internal workflow, and assists with contract review along with training other departments in coordination with the Bank’s legal counsel. This position meets with departments to review upcoming contract renewals, manages the purchase order process, creates and sends purchase orders to vendors, closes completed purchase orders, approves facility invoices as needed, and works with Accounts Payable and vendors to resolve invoicing discrepancies. The Senior Procurement Analyst also supports other projects as needed or assigned.

Since 1986, we have been committed to working with the communities we serve using innovative tools and resources that provide opportunities to gain stability, build generational wealth or start a business.
Sunrise Banks was founded by David Reiling, a social entrepreneur and innovator on the cutting edge of fintech and financial wellness. He strives to forge meaningful partnerships that drive sustainable economic growth. The bank, driven by David’s vision, focuses on positive community engagement and partners with like-minded companies to extend its mission nationally and around the world.
